Toofaan, Sarpatta Parambarai: Amazon Prime Video Sets Up Battle Of Boxers!

Amazon Prime Video has struck gold. With the number of movies scheduled to release Amazon Prime Video is winning the game at this point. One big event for Amazon is always Prime Day and if you are an avid Prime user, you would know that not only the website goes crazy with sales, but Prime Video launches exceptional amounts of movies, series, and original shows as a celebration for Prime Day. This time for Prime Day, Amazon Prime Video has a battle set up for the fans.

Well, if you are not aware, Prime Video has acquired the rights to Farhan Akhtar starrer “Toofaan”. Toofaan is a sports drama that is set to release on the 16th of July, 2021 on Amazon Prime Video. Besides Farhan Akhtar, the movie stars Mrunal Thakur and Paresh Rawal in pivotal roles, along with Hashim Azmi, Vijay Raaz, Darshan Kumar, Supriya Pathak, Hussain Dalal, and Dr. Mohan Agashe.

The movie tells the story of a small-time gangster Ajju Bhai, who has a knack for boxing and under constant pressure from his lady-love; he finally gives in and joins a boxing competition. After that, there’s no looking back, as he goes on to a national-level boxing champion.

While Amazon has a big movie like Toofaan in the ring, today it released the trailer of another movie set to release on the platform on 22nd July. “Sarpatta Parambarai”, the Tamil movie starring Arya in the lead, along with Kalaiyarasan, Pasupathi, John Kokken, Santhosh Pratap, Shabeer Kallarakkal, John Vijay, Akali Venkat and Muthukumar.

The movie follows the story of two clans who are up against each other in the field of boxing. While one of the clans has a strong contender, the other needs to put up someone who can defeat him and bring glory to their clan. This is where Arya’s character Kabilan comes in, as he trains to become a boxer, but gets derailed midway as he gets embroiled in crimes. Leading to him getting out of the clan, he vows to make a comeback and get into the ring stronger than ever.

Both these movies will be released on Prime Video, as a means of celebrating Prime Day. Both of these have the same themes but are set in different eras. Both of these tell the story of the same sport but from the perspective of two different people. Both these movies will battle it out as both of them have leading stars in the movie and are also two of the much-awaited movies on OTT.
